CITY COMMISSION BRIEFING For Meeting Scheduled for December 3, 2009 Request Franchise on the Beach by Eugene Patty TO: FROM: THRU: RE: Mayor Leon Skip Beeler and Members of the City Commission Anthony Caravella, AICP, Director of Development Services Chuck Billias, City Manager Review request (Attachment A ) from Eugene Patty to authorize a franchise to sell ice cream and water on the ocean beach. Agenda Item H-2 DATE: November 30, 2009 NOTE: The action being requested (copy presented as Attachment A ) is not a staff initiated agenda item and staff recommends the Commission deny Mr. Patty s request. This briefing has been prepared by staff for the purpose of providing support information to the City Commission to aid in the decision being requested by Mr. Patty. A. Background/General Information and Introduction City Code Section 15-39 prohibits sales and leases on the City s ocean beach. This code section reads: Sec. 15-39. Certain sales and leases along Atlantic Ocean beach area prohibited; punishment for violations. It shall be unlawful for any person, association of persons, or legal entity, directly or indirectly, or through or as an owner, agent or employee, or in any other capacity, to offer for sale or lease or to sell, or lease, or in any way to offer to deliver or transfer, or to deliver or transfer, for cash or on credit, or to participate in any manner towards the accomplishment of any of the foregoing, any merchandise of any kind, including, but not limited to, food and beverage, in the area adjacent to the Atlantic Ocean and extending westerly therefrom to the "Sea Wall Line," provided for in section 5-45 of this Code, and extending north and south to the northernmost and southernmost boundaries of the city, unless such activities be pursuant to franchise or resolution of the city commission entered of record, except such activities aforesaid as may be otherwise lawfully conducted at permanent structures in said area, and the possession by said person, association of persons, or legal entity of a license to do business in the city does not, of itself, permit the activities herein prohibited. The prohibition herein contained shall not be construed to permit any uses of said area inconsistent with any zoning or other ordinance of the city. Violations of this section shall be punished according to law. Briefing Memorandum to: Mayor Leon Skip Beeler and Members of the City Commission Re: Eugene Patty request for franchise for sales on the ocean beach Date: November 30, 2009 for Commission Meeting on December 3, 2009 Page 2 Note the cited code section also provides for unless such activities be pursuant to franchise or resolution of the city commission entered of record. Therefore, Mr. Patty is requesting the City Commission authorize a franchise or resolution to sell ice cream and water on the ocean beach. There are presently only four franchises or resolutions approved by the City Commission authorizing sales on the ocean beach. These four franchises are Adrian Dillon at Shepard Park, Mr. Rosenberry abutting Pulsipher Avenue, the Cocoa Beach Pier, and Coconut s Restaurant. o The Dillon and Rosenberry franchises are for rental of beach equipment; there are no consumables sold by these two long standing and long-term franchise holders. o The Pier and Coconut s franchises are historic fixed location real property operations with riparian rights on the beach (and in the case of the Pier - a State of Florida lease) and in which the franchise holder maintains trash containers for consumable materials and conducts franchise rights at permanent structure. The Commission has previously set forth a policy and direction that there will be no additional franchises on the ocean beach. As support to that policy, the City Commission has adopted the following Comprehensive Plan policy: Policy III.4.12: In order to avoid excessive stress on City beaches, dunes and the beachfront parks and the Brevard County owned beachfront parks and public areas within the city, and in order to avoid unnecessary traffic control and parking management problems, the City shall prohibit all commercial activities on the City beaches [emphasis added], dunes and beachfront parks, unless those activities are conducted pursuant to City issued franchises an or special event permits, but may be otherwise subject to any interlocal agreement between the city and Brevard County in respect to county owned beachfront parks and public areas within the city. City staff had previously responded to a public records request by Mr. Patty regarding the issue of sales on the beach. A copy of this City response to records request # 2009-24 is presented as Attachment B. In that records request, Mr. Patty was advised Therefore, selling goods on the beach is not permitted pursuant to City Code Section 15-39, City Comprehensive Plan Policy III.4.12, and City Land Development Code Section 3-12. Mr. Patty had been cited for violating City Code Section 15-39. Mr. Patty did appeal the citation to County Court. The court upheld the City s citation. A copy of the latest court rulings in this matter are presented as Attachment C.

Key Facts/Issues Requiring Discussion Does the Commission desire to modify its long standing policy of not approving additional franchises on the ocean beach? Would such a change in policy require a Comprehensive Plan amendment, and the process required for such an amendment, in order to solicit public input before any policy change? 2. Costs Not applicable. If the Commission desires to proceed forward, franchise fees will need to be negotiated and determined. 3. Savings. Not applicable. 4. Source of Funds. Not applicable. 5. Communications Not applicable. 6. Environmental Impact. Not applicable. 7. Department Representatives Anthony Caravella, AICP, Director of Development Services 8. Staff Recommendation Staff does not recommend approval. Additional franchises on the beach are not consistent with the City Comprehensive Plan and long standing City policy. 9. Recommended Motion: If for denial: I move to deny the request by Eugene Patty for a franchise to sell ice cream and water on the ocean beach. If for approval: I move to authorize the City Manager to negotiate a franchise agreement with Eugene Patty to sell ice cream and water on the ocean beach, with the final agreement to be approved by resolution of the City Commission.
